Neutral Color Schemes

Generally, neutral color schemes are often preferred by couples who want to create a calm and serene atmosphere in their living room, as they can effortlessly complement a wide range of decor styles.
Incorporating natural tones and earthy shades, such as beige, taupe, and sage, can add warmth and depth to the space.
These neutral hues provide a versatile backdrop for introducing patterned textiles, statement furniture pieces, and personal decorative items, allowing couples to express their individual styles while maintaining a sense of harmony and balance in the room.

Rug Selection Tips

A well-chosen rug can dramatically enhance the aesthetic and functionality of a living room, serving as a unifying element that ties together the various design components.
Consider rug material, rug texture, when making a selection.
- *Rug material* options include wool, silk, and synthetic fibers
- *Rug texture* can add depth and visual interest
- Patterned rugs can hide stains
- Neutral-colored rugs provide versatility.

Mixing Old Styles

Blending vintage and modern elements, such as distressed furniture and sleek decor, can create a unique aesthetic in a living room, allowing couples to showcase their individual tastes while still maintaining a cohesive look.
This approach often involves antique restoration and retro renovation techniques.
- 1. Reupholstering vintage chairs
- 2. Refinishing wooden floors
- 3. Incorporating retro lighting fixtures
- 4. Mixing antique and modern artwork, creating a balanced space that reflects both partners' styles.

Decorating Small Spaces

Couples who have successfully merged their styles to create a harmonious living room may still face another significant challenge: optimizing the space to accommodate their needs.
Effective space planning and storage solutions are vital in small spaces.
Consider the following strategies:
- Multi-functional furniture
- Vertical storage
- Hidden compartments
- Reflective decor, to create a sense of openness and flow, ultimately enhancing the overall ambiance of the room through innovative design techniques.
